METHOD FOR MANUFACTURING A BODY MADE OF A POROUS MATERIAL

    Applicant: BASF SE

    Abstract: The present invention relates to a method for manufacturing a body made of a porous material derived from precursors of the porous material in a sol-gel process, comprising (i) providing a mold (10), wherein the mold (10) comprises a lower part (12) defining an interior volume for receiving the precursors of the porous material, wherein the interior volume defines the shape of the body to be manufactured, wherein the lower part (12)comprises a first opening (20), and at least a first opening (20) through which the body isremovable from the lower part (12), wherein surfaces of the lower part (12) facing the interior volume are at least partially provided with a coating (26) made of a material being electrically dissipative and non-sticky to the precursors of the porous materialand/or the body, (ii) filling precursors of the porous material into the lower part (12) in a first inert or ventilated region (52), wherein the precursors include two reactive components (CA, CB) and a solvent (S), (iii)removing the body from the lower part (12) through the first opening (20) after a predetermined time in which the body is formed from the precursors of the porous material, (iv) disposing the body onto a support (66), and (v) removing the solvent (S) from the body.

    PROCESS FOR PRODUCING POLYCARBODIIMIDE

    Abstract: A process for producing a polycarbodiimide, comprising polymerizing a diisocyanate in the presence of a carbodiimidization catalyst in a reaction vessel in liquid phase at a temperature in the range of from 20 to 250 °C, at a pressure in the range of from 20 to 800 mbar and in the presence of at least one inert gas, wherein the at least one inert gas is introduced into the liquid phase in the reaction vessel with a flow rate in the range of from 0.1 x/h to 100 x/h, x being the volume of the reaction vessel.
